Over a year ago I purchased 3 fold up solar panels for my preps and other projects. I have both their standard and higher efficiency models. Often the basic components of these panels are shared by multiple makers. Near as I can tell the Allpowers is the same as Anker etc etc etc. We will be reviewing both the 12 and 16 watt 5 volt models.


Here are the stats for the 16 watt model.


Solar Panel: 16W
* Transformation efficiency: >17%-19%
* Total Output: 5V2A
* Fold: 232 x 160 x 13mm/ 9.1 x 6.3 x 0.51inch(Size as notebook)
* Open: 800 x 232 x 1mm/31.5 x 9.1 x 0.04inch
* Weight: 0.62kg/21.8oz

12 watt model.


Specification:
* Solar panel peak power: 12W
* Transformation efficiency: >17%-19%
* Total Output: 5V1.5A(Max1.7A)
* Fold: 232 x 160 x 10mm/ 9.1 x 6.3 x 0.39inch
* Open: 645 x 232 x 1mm/ 25.4 x 9.1 x 0.04inch
* Weight: 0.51kg/17.9oz

Lets take a look.





I am guessing each panel is 4 watts.





They both have duel USB charging ports and multiple tie-off loops.





Ready for the test.





I ended up charging an Ipad and Iphone off the 16 watt and cheap android tablet with year old not used totally dead batter off the 12.








So after 1 hour the 16 watt charged the Ipad 30%, Iphone also 30% which is really good IMHO. It was charging two things at the same time after all and that Ipad is a slow charger IMHO. The 12 watt panel only charged the long dead android tablet 10% however I think the over discharged state of the battery slowed the process. I left both the Ipad and android plugged in then went fishing. Came back later at night and both were charged 100%. The next day I tested the 12 watt as normally it's faster than 10% an hour.











10% in 14 minutes isn't bad. It can also charge many USB powered device I have tried.

Not all USB battery chargers are fully solar compatible. Some chargers and devices will trigger an error mode if the voltage input gets too sporadic. Such as passing clouds.





If you really need the power sometimes it's best to charge a solar compatible battery pack then charge devices from that. Granted there will be conversion loss but could be worth it. Here is a video showing the panels in action. So far after over a year they're working just fine.
